Introduction to Fort Dix, New Jersey

Located in Burlington County, New Jersey, Fort Dix is a small community with a rich history. It is part of the United States Army Support Activity, which also includes McGuire Air Force Base and Naval Air Engineering Station Lakehurst. The combined installation is known as Joint Base McGuire-Dix-Lakehurst. Fort Dix is named in honor of Major General John Adams Dix, a veteran of the War of 1812 and the Civil War.

Fort Dix is not just a military base; it is also home to a small population of civilians. As of the 2010 census, the population of Fort Dix was approximately 7,716. The community is diverse, with a mix of military personnel, civilian employees, and their families. The area is known for its strong sense of community and its commitment to supporting the military.

How to Request Fort Dix Public Records

To request Fort Dix Public Records, you will need to contact the appropriate government agency. This could be the Burlington County Clerk's Office, the New Jersey Department of Military and Veterans Affairs, or another relevant agency. It's important to note that while most public records are accessible, some may be restricted due to privacy laws or security concerns.

The Burlington County Clerk's Office can be reached at (609) 265-5122. Their office is located at 49 Rancocas Road, Mount Holly, NJ 08060. More information can be found on their website at www.co.burlington.nj.us/290/County-Clerk.

The New Jersey Department of Military and Veterans Affairs can be contacted at (609) 530-4600. Their office is located at 101 Eggert Crossing Road, Lawrenceville, NJ 08648. More information can be found on their website at www.nj.gov/military.
